How To Convert Tablespoon US to Cubic Millimeter

Formula: 1 Tablespoon US = 14,786.76478125 Cubic Millimeter.

Example: Convert 3.5 Tablespoon US to Cubic Millimeter.

3.5 × 14,786.76478125 = 51,753.676734375 mm³

To convert by hand, you multiply the number of tablespoons by the cubic millimeters in 1 tablespoon.

This works because a US tablespoon is a fixed volume, and cubic millimeter is just a smaller volume unit.

If you need to go the other way, divide by the same number.

Conversion Formula

mm³ = tbsp × 14,786.76478125
tbsp = mm³ ÷ 14,786.76478125

This means every time you have 1 US tablespoon of volume, it equals 14,786.76478125 cubic millimeters. Since cubic millimeter is very small, the number looks large.

Why this exact number. A US tablespoon is 14.78676478125 milliliters, and 1 milliliter is exactly 1,000 mm³. So 14.78676478125 × 1,000 = 14,786.76478125 mm³.

Tablespoon US

A Tablespoon US is a common cooking volume unit used in the United States. Its symbol is tbsp.

It comes from traditional kitchen measuring spoons and was later tied to the US fluid ounce so it stays consistent in recipes and food labels.

Cubic Millimeter

A Cubic Millimeter is a metric unit of volume equal to a cube that is 1 millimeter on each side. Its symbol is mm³.

It is based on the metric system and is used when you need very small, precise volumes, especially in science, engineering, and manufacturing.
